Huntington Beach will now allow police officers to issue various citations for misusing e-bikes. They would also be able to confiscate them from underaged riders.

Huntington Beach will now allow police officers to issue various citations for misusing e-bikes, or even impound them.Many people in Huntington Beach enjoyed the last full day of summer by cruising up and down the coast. For many like Tamara Doss of Riverside, the most popular way to get around is on electric bicycles.

However, the popular bikes have also created a new level of danger for drivers, pedestrians and other bicyclists. The new ordinance gives the Huntington Beach Police Department the discretion to issue tickets to riders breaking the law. "Anytime we see someone doing something that is clearly unsafe, or that we can articulate is clearly unsafe, or if it's something that's already established in the vehicle code, like running a red light, running a stop sign, speeding, changing lanes without discretion for anyone around them," said HBPD Lt. Thoby Archer.
